How come my CVR's aren't punching that hard?

My CVRs are dual 4 ohm wired to 2 ohms. I'm using 4 gauge wire. I just don't get why my subs aren't punching hard like they should.
If u have to dual 4ohm subs they can't be wired to 2 ohms. A single D4 sub can be wired to 2 ohms but not 2 of them.
